The present petition has been filed by the Petitioner- M/s Shri Shyam Metals (India) under Articles 226 and 227 of the Constitution of India, inter alia, challenging the impugned Order-in-Appeal dated 13th May, 2025 passed by the Additional Commissioner, COST Appeals-1, Delhi (hereinafter 'impugned OIA'). The appeal decided in the impugned OIA was filed challenging the impugned Order-in-Original dated 30th April, 2024, passed by the Assistant Commissioner, CGST (hereinafter 'impugned OIO'), which has also been challenged by the Petitioner in the present petition. 3.

Mr. Verma, ld. Counsel, submits that the pre-deposit constituting 10% of the demand raised has already been made by the Petitioner. 4.

Upon the constitution of the GST Appellate Tribunal and functioning being commenced thereof, the Petitioner is free to file the appeal challenging the impugned OIA.

6.

It is noted that the present petition also challenges the vires of the Notification No.

56/2023Central Tax dated 28th December, 2023(hereinafter, 'impugned notification'). Thus, any order passed by the GST Appellate Tribunal shall be subject to the outcome of the decision of the Supreme Court in S.L.P No 4240/2025 titled M/s HCC-SEW-MEILAAG JV v. Assistant Commissioner of State Tax &Ors. 7.

The petition is disposed of in these terms. All pending applications, if any, are also disposed of.
